Thermogravimetric and Mass Spectrometric Equipment is an instrument used to study the thermal decomposition and volatile products of materials. It heats a sample while simultaneously measuring the change in mass of the sample and the composition of the volatile products. Thermogravimetric and mass spectrometric equipment is widely used in fields such as materials science, chemistry, and environmental science to study the thermal stability, decomposition mechanisms, and compositional analysis of materials.
